Since in Allah's sight Ghulām Dastagir Qaṣūrī was the wrongdoer, he did not even get the respite to see the publication of his book, and died even before its publication; everyone knows that he died within a few days after his prayer. Some ignorant maulawis write that Ghulām Dastagir did not do the mubahalah; he had only prayed against the wrongdoer. But I say that when he had sought God's adjudication with my death and had declared me to be the wrongdoer, why then did that malediction backfire upon him? Why did God single out Ghulām Dastagīr for death at such a critical time when people were eagerly awaiting the verdict from God; whereas he wished my death in his prayer in order to prove to the world that just as a false Mahdi and false Messiah had died as a result of Muḥammad Tahir's malediction, so would I die as a result of his prayer? Why then was the effect of his prayer exactly the opposite? It is true that a false Mahdi and a false Messiah had died as a result of Muḥammad Tahir's malediction and emulating that same Muḥammad Ṭahir, Ghulām Dastagīr had prayed against me. It is indeed a point to ponder as to what the effect of Muḥammad Tahir's malediction was and what the effect of Ghulām Dastagīr's prayer was.
